Kollmorgen LE10565 CD Servo Driver is designed for precision motion control in automation systems. The driver operates on a 230 VAC, 3-phase power supply and delivers reliable performance for various applications, including robotics and packaging.
The LE10565 CD servo driver can meet short-term torque demands with its continuous 20 A output current and peak 60 A output current. Roughly 5.5 kW is its nominal output power. For precise control of the motor, the driver has digital current and velocity loops. To accommodate a variety of motor feedback devices, the driver provides both encoder and resolver feedback. The panel may be mounted in controlled settings due to the IP20 enclosure grade. Flexible integration of the CD servo driver with automation networks is made possible via communication interfaces such as Ethernet/IP, Profinet, and EtherCAT. Servo drivers also have safety features that meet Performance Level "d" or "e" criteria and are compliant with SIL2/SIL3. Through the provision of trustworthy defect detection and safe operating modes, these safety functions contribute to the reduction of risks associated with automated machinery.
